Cascaded hybrid convolutional autoencoder network for spectral-spatial nonlinear hyperspectral unmixing
Due to the complex interaction of photons between materials, linear hyperspectral unmixing (HU) is limited in real scenarios, making nonlinear unmixing a promising alternative.
